首页
/ Postwoman长请求体搜索显示异常问题分析与解决

Postwoman长请求体搜索显示异常问题分析与解决

2025-04-29 22:09:34作者:宣利权Counsellor

在Postwoman项目使用过程中,用户反馈了一个关于请求体搜索功能的显示问题。当用户在较长的请求体内容中进行搜索操作后,滚动到页面底部时,会出现部分内容显示为空白区域的情况。

问题现象描述 用户提交了一个包含大量内容的请求体后,执行搜索功能并滚动至页面底部,发现本该显示的内容区域变成了空白。从用户提供的截图可以清晰看到,在请求体编辑区域的下半部分出现了明显的空白区块。

技术原因分析 经过技术团队排查,这个问题可能由以下几个因素导致:

  1. 虚拟滚动机制失效:Postwoman可能采用了虚拟滚动技术来优化长列表渲染性能,但在搜索操作后,虚拟滚动的计算可能出现偏差。

  2. DOM渲染异常:搜索功能可能触发了内容的重新渲染,但在处理长内容时,浏览器未能正确计算和渲染所有DOM元素。

  3. 样式计算错误:CSS样式可能在动态内容更新后没有正确应用,导致部分区域无法正常显示。

解决方案 开发团队针对此问题进行了以下优化:

  1. 改进了虚拟滚动算法:确保在搜索操作后能正确计算和渲染可见区域的内容。

  2. 增加了渲染验证机制:在内容更新后强制进行完整的布局重计算,避免出现渲染残留。

  3. 优化了搜索功能的内存管理:防止因大量内容搜索导致的内存泄漏或渲染中断。

最佳实践建议 对于用户在使用类似工具时的建议:

  1. 对于超长请求体,建议考虑分块处理或使用文件上传方式。

  2. 定期清理不再需要的请求历史,保持工具运行效率。

  3. 遇到显示异常时,可以尝试缩小/放大编辑器或切换布局模式来触发重新渲染。

该问题已在最新版本中得到修复,用户升级后即可获得正常的搜索体验。

登录后查看全文
热门项目推荐
相关项目推荐